#include "config.h"
#include <locale.h>
#include <stdlib.h>
#include <unistd.h>
#include <string.h>
#include "libgsystem.h"
#include "libglnx/libglnx.h"
#include "xdg-app-builtins.h"
#include "xdg-app-utils.h"
static char *opt_subject;
static char *opt_body;
static GOptionEntry options[] = {
{ "subject", 's', 0, G_OPTION_ARG_STRING, &opt_subject, "One line subject", "SUBJECT" },
{ "body", 'b', 0, G_OPTION_ARG_STRING, &opt_body, "Full description", "BODY" },
{ NULL }
};
static gboolean
metadata_get_arch (GFile *file, char **out_arch, GError **error)
{
gboolean ret = FALSE;
g_autofree char *path = NULL;
g_autoptr(GKeyFile) keyfile = NULL;
g_autofree char *runtime = NULL;
glnx_strfreev char **parts = NULL;
keyfile = g_key_file_new ();
path = g_file_get_path (file);
if (!g_key_file_load_from_file (keyfile, path, G_KEY_FILE_NONE, error))
goto out;
runtime = g_key_file_get_string (keyfile, "Application", "runtime", error);
if (*error)
goto out;
parts = g_strsplit (runtime, "/", 0);
if (g_strv_length (parts) != 3)
{
g_set_error (error, G_IO_ERROR, G_IO_ERROR_FAILED, "Failed to determine arch from metadata runtime key: %s", runtime);
goto out;
}
*out_arch = g_strdup (parts[1]);
ret = TRUE;
out:
return ret;
}
static gboolean
is_empty_directory (GFile *file, GCancellable *cancellable)
{
g_autoptr(GFileEnumerator) file_enum = NULL;
g_autoptr(GFileInfo) child_info = NULL;
file_enum = g_file_enumerate_children (file, G_FILE_ATTRIBUTE_STANDARD_NAME,
G_FILE_QUERY_INFO_NONE,
cancellable, NULL);
if (!file_enum)
return FALSE;
child_info = g_file_enumerator_next_file (file_enum, cancellable, NULL);
if (child_info)
return FALSE;
return TRUE;
}
static OstreeRepoCommitFilterResult
commit_filter (OstreeRepo *repo,
const char *path,
GFileInfo *file_info,
gpointer user_data)
{
if (g_str_equal (path, "/") ||
g_str_equal (path, "/metadata") ||
g_str_has_prefix (path, "/files") ||
g_str_has_prefix (path, "/export"))
{
g_debug ("commit filter, allow: %s", path);
return OSTREE_REPO_COMMIT_FILTER_ALLOW;
}
else
{
g_debug ("commit filter, skip: %s", path);
return OSTREE_REPO_COMMIT_FILTER_SKIP;
}
}
gboolean
xdg_app_builtin_build_export (int argc, char **argv, GCancellable *cancellable, GError **error)
{
gboolean ret = FALSE;
GOptionContext *context;
g_autoptr(GFile) base = NULL;
g_autoptr(GFile) files = NULL;
g_autoptr(GFile) metadata = NULL;
g_autoptr(GFile) export = NULL;
g_autoptr(GFile) repofile = NULL;
g_autoptr(GFile) arg = NULL;
g_autoptr(GFile) root = NULL;
g_autoptr(OstreeRepo) repo = NULL;
const char *location;
const char *directory;
const char *name;
const char *branch;
g_autofree char *arch = NULL;
g_autofree char *full_branch = NULL;
g_autofree char *parent = NULL;
g_autofree char *commit_checksum = NULL;
g_autoptr(OstreeMutableTree) mtree = NULL;
char *subject = NULL;
g_autofree char *body = NULL;
OstreeRepoTransactionStats stats;
OstreeRepoCommitModifier *modifier = NULL;
context = g_option_context_new ("LOCATION DIRECTORY NAME [BRANCH] - Create a repository from a build directory");
if (!xdg_app_option_context_parse (context, options, &argc, &argv, XDG_APP_BUILTIN_FLAG_NO_DIR, NULL, cancellable, error))
goto out;
if (argc < 4)
{
usage_error (context, "LOCATION, DIRECTORY and NAME must be specified", error);
goto out;
}
location = argv[1];
directory = argv[2];
name = argv[3];
if (!xdg_app_is_valid_name (name))
{
g_set_error (error, G_IO_ERROR, G_IO_ERROR_FAILED, "'%s' is not a valid application name", name);
goto out;
}
if (argc >= 5)
branch = argv[4];
else
branch = "master";
if (!xdg_app_is_valid_branch (branch))
{
g_set_error (error, G_IO_ERROR, G_IO_ERROR_FAILED, "'%s' is not a valid branch name", branch);
goto out;
}
base = g_file_new_for_commandline_arg (directory);
files = g_file_get_child (base, "files");
metadata = g_file_get_child (base, "metadata");
export = g_file_get_child (base, "export");
if (!g_file_query_exists (files, cancellable) ||
!g_file_query_exists (metadata, cancellable))
{
g_set_error (error, G_IO_ERROR, G_IO_ERROR_FAILED, "Build directory %s not initialized", directory);
goto out;
}
if (!g_file_query_exists (export, cancellable))
{
g_set_error (error, G_IO_ERROR, G_IO_ERROR_FAILED, "Build directory %s not finalized", directory);
goto out;
}
if (!metadata_get_arch (metadata, &arch, error))
goto out;
if (opt_subject)
subject = opt_subject;
else
subject = "Import an application build";
if (opt_body)
body = g_strdup (opt_body);
else
body = g_strconcat ("Name: ", name, "\nArch: ", arch, "\nBranch: ", branch, NULL);
full_branch = g_strconcat ("app/", name, "/", arch, "/", branch, NULL);
repofile = g_file_new_for_commandline_arg (location);
repo = ostree_repo_new (repofile);
if (g_file_query_exists (repofile, cancellable) &&
!is_empty_directory (repofile, cancellable))
{
if (!ostree_repo_open (repo, cancellable, error))
goto out;
if (!ostree_repo_resolve_rev (repo, full_branch, TRUE, &parent, error))
goto out;
}
else
{
if (!ostree_repo_create (repo, OSTREE_REPO_MODE_ARCHIVE_Z2, cancellable, error))
goto out;
}
if (!ostree_repo_prepare_transaction (repo, NULL, cancellable, error))
goto out;
mtree = ostree_mutable_tree_new ();
arg = g_file_new_for_commandline_arg (directory);
modifier = ostree_repo_commit_modifier_new (0, commit_filter, NULL, NULL);
if (!ostree_repo_write_directory_to_mtree (repo, arg, mtree, modifier, cancellable, error))
goto out;
if (!ostree_repo_write_mtree (repo, mtree, &root, cancellable, error))
goto out;
if (!ostree_repo_write_commit (repo, parent, subject, body, NULL,
OSTREE_REPO_FILE (root),
&commit_checksum, cancellable, error))
goto out;
ostree_repo_transaction_set_ref (repo, NULL, full_branch, commit_checksum);
if (!ostree_repo_commit_transaction (repo, &stats, cancellable, error))
goto out;
g_print ("Commit: %s\n", commit_checksum);
g_print ("Metadata Total: %u\n", stats.metadata_objects_total);
g_print ("Metadata Written: %u\n", stats.metadata_objects_written);
g_print ("Content Total: %u\n", stats.content_objects_total);
g_print ("Content Written: %u\n", stats.content_objects_written);
g_print ("Content Bytes Written: %" G_GUINT64_FORMAT "\n", stats.content_bytes_written);
ret = TRUE;
out:
if (repo)
ostree_repo_abort_transaction (repo, cancellable, NULL);
if (context)
g_option_context_free (context);
if (modifier)
ostree_repo_commit_modifier_unref (modifier);
return ret;
}
